Output 2ef07a6c3dea8fb2a04066d23ce4f59c2fbab1b06cc9846a3bf8295aaffc82ab:1

value
11367825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0126ab5bcfe2291594c2cb03c9691c5ca09270da OP_EQUAL
address
31o6vXiqD9RuECfk3Rhjb26LnUnQxMczrY
transaction
2ef07a6c3dea8fb2a04066d23ce4f59c2fbab1b06cc9846a3bf8295aaffc82ab
confirmations
268758
spent
true